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Danish Haffredall, originally derived from Old Danish Hawærydh. The original being a compound of have (“pasture”) + ryd (“clearing”). Then shortened to "Haverda", via the parish dialect to "Haverd", plus the added plural suffix -a (For unkown reason many place-names are in plural form, despite often referring to a single feature.). "Haverda" was then, via folk etymology, transformed to its contemporary form "Haverdal"; where dal means "dale" or "valley". The original form Hawærydh is first attested in 1466. The dal (“dale”) form is attested since 1603 as Haffredall.
